Fix WInidows Problems: Cannot find a running instance of Steam

When trying to play a game like Dayz, some users might annoyingly get an error message saying “Cannot find a running instance of Steam”. This is really frustrating. Moreover, even though they have tried running steam as an administrator, flushing out Steam, restarting steam, restarting the computer, none of these has fixed the issue. What is going on and how to get rid of this computer error message immediately?


If you are at the first time to receive the message “Cannot find a running instance of Steam” in playing a game, turn off the computer and restart it several minutes later. A temporary issue on the machine sometimes might result in the appearance of such an error message and “Your PC ran into a problem” message, and it can be fixed immediately after a system reboot.

If the message remains, right click the game that you are going to launch and press Properties, and go to Local Files and press the “Verify Cache” or something like that, enable the developement beta build in the properties. Sometimes, a problem within the computer itself can stop you from playing the game and display the message saying “Cannot find a running instance of Steam”.

However, a problem within the Steam itself at most of the time has been the major cause of this error message. If the two solutions above fail, uninstall and reinstall Steam so as to get rid of this annoying error message:

- Make a backup of the SteamApps/Common folder on either an external HDD or in another folder of your PC.
- Go to Start, Control Panel, Add/Remove Programs and uninstall Steam.
- Search and delete the Steam folder in its integrity. Sometimes, a folder with some properties is still there even if you have followed the above steps to go. You should manually search for this folder and completely delete it.
- Reinstall Steam and you may be able to play the game without the message “Cannot find a running instance of Steam”.
